Met Gala 2018: Heavenly bodies! Rihanna steals the show again in racy papal outfit at Catholic-themed red carpet alongside Kim Kardashian and Jennifer Lopez
Forget Halloween, for celebrities dress-up time happens in May – at the annual Met Gala.
And fashion’s biggest night didn’t let style fans down on Monday, as the stars revealed their imaginative takes on the theme Heavenly Bodies: Fashion and the Catholic Imagination.
Dripping in gold, a busty Kim Kardashian showed off her heavenly body in a skin-tight Versace sheath, while Jennifer Lopez went all out in a bedazzled jeweled Balmain gown.
But it was pop star Rihanna, always one to push the boundaries of fashion, who took over the carpet at The Metropolitan Museum of Art in a jaw dropping Pope inspired mini dress and jacket with a matching hat by Maison Margiela.
Rihanna dazzled in her heavily beaded white and black mini dress with a matching jacket and hat – from Maison Margiela by John Galliano.
The songstress’s inspiration was clear – with the papal influence undeniable. Of course there were some key moderations – the beaded ensemble was cut so to show off her cleavage, as well as her toned legs.
The 30-year-old beauty’s strapless gown featured two different hemlines; she added a coordinating coat and hat with a chunky necklace and Christian Louboutin heels.
Rihanna painted her pout a gold and mauve hue with charcoal colored smokey eye makeup.
